The infatuation with stadiums was loud and clear in 2024, as one of the most talked-about news stories revolved around the controversial development at the Cleveland Browns' home turf. The proposed renovations and expansions have sparked heated debates among fans, city officials, and local residents. Many supporters argue that the upgrades will enhance the fan experience and bring economic benefits to the area, while critics raise concerns about potential disruptions and the environmental impact of such large-scale projects.
In addition to the Cleveland Browns, other teams across the nation have also been in the spotlight for their stadium plans. From state-of-the-art facilities to renovations of historic venues, the conversation surrounding sports infrastructure continues to grow. The year has seen a surge in discussions about funding, community involvement, and the future of sports in urban environments.
As cities compete to attract major sporting events, the tension between development and community needs remains a critical issue. The ongoing changes in stadium projects are sure to influence the landscape of sports for years to come.
